Anyway. I too found plenty of fish, although most were in the shorter range. I kept 5 from 13.5-15 and threw back 5-10 more in the 10-13" range along with 3 whites and countless sheepshead. I was running two crawler harnesses and one crank. Harnesses were 20-45 back on 1oz and 3/4 oz bottom bouncers. I had the best luck on chartruse colorado blade.

Anyway, I focused mostly near reef areas and the adjacent mud. Mostly 12-15 fow. I pretty much focused on the bottom 5 feet as this is were every fish was marked. I fished between Neenah and Oshkosh.

I don't believe the big fish are mixed in with the little ones. Big fish definately group together. You might find a big one mixed in here and there but thats about it. If I catch 6 or 8 little ones or so and no big fish yet, the rest of the fish I catch are usually small too.
